TCLP clauses are suitable for translation into other jurisdictions

TCLP clauses are suitable for translation in other jurisdictions but translation needs to take into consideration different terminology and procedural rules. The clauses have the greatest impact when they are translated into legal databases. This means that lawyers will have to consider the translation process carefully.

TCLP clauses are drafted in English, but if you are translating a clause for use in a different jurisdiction, ensure that you use your own professional judgment and seek independent legal advice. The clauses are written with English and Welsh law in mind but may also be appropriate to use in a different jurisdiction.

The proposed amendments will allow contract termination under limited environmental circumstances, which could include issues such as climate change. However, the proposed clauses do not provide guidance on the payment consequences of terminating the contract in this way. Therefore, users of these clauses should carefully review their agreement to determine whether this clause will trigger other consequences.
